#361d0c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#361d0c is composed of 21.2% red, 11.4% green and 4.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 46.3% magenta, 77.8% yellow and 78.8% black. It has a hue angle of 24.3 degrees, a saturation of 63.6% and a lightness of 12.9%. #361d0c color hex could be obtained by blending #6c3a18 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

● #361d0c color description : Very dark orange [Brown tone].
#361d0c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#361d0c has RGB values of R:54, G:29, B:12 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.46, Y:0.78, K:0.79. Its decimal value is 3546380.
